I don't have the assets anymore, but I do at least have a screenshot.I'm not quite sure if I'm able to make Miku an animated Character in Trainz.
First off. I am not familiar with animating "human like" characters. I tried MMD twice, it was endlessly frustrating for me both times.
Secondly. I might run issues with how she is rigged, her face expression are controlled by Vertex Groups and Shape Keys, it is not designed to be reanimated with bone.
Speaking of bones
Issue number three (most important)
influence bones vs skeleton, they do the same function on paper (acts as the container for rigs in the .IM (index mesh) However they are very different in how the game treats them. I might have issues finding a way to bind Miku's skin to the rig without it separating during the export (since I use blender)
There has been only one animated human model in trainz history, that is like this (meaning it one single fleshy model that can deform at the joints. No like an action figure where every part is separate)
The guy shoveling coal in the old PB15 cab interior.
Yes that crusty old model that has been in trainz since like... 2004 has a an animated 3D character beforewaifugacha games were even a thing.
